Set on over 1.3 acres in Lakehills, Texas, this 4-bedroom, 2-bath home with a detached guest house (ADU) offers the perfect blend of country living with convenient access to San Antonio. Ideal for buyers seeking Hill Country property, multigenerational living, rental income potential, or space to spread out, this unique homestead delivers flexibility, privacy, and stunning views. The main residence features a spacious open living room, a large kitchen with island, and an eat-in dining area, creating a functional layout for everyday living and entertaining. All kitchen appliances convey, and a dedicated laundry room adds convenience. The primary suite is generously sized and includes a walk-in closet, ceiling fan, and en-suite bathroom with a walk-in shower, soaking tub, and vanity. Three additional bedrooms provide comfortable space, each with ceiling fans and ample closet storage. Outdoor living truly shines with a covered front porch overlooking the Texas Hill Country, a long private driveway, and two separate 2-car carports offering abundant parking. The property also includes expansive decking leading to the detached guest house, making it ideal for hosting visitors or creating a private retreat. The detached guest house (approximately 400 sq ft) includes a large open room that can function as a bedroom and living space, a kitchenette with sink, refrigerator, and cabinet storage, plus a full bathroom and closet. A covered porch and accessibility ramp enhance usability, making this space perfect for extended family, guests, or potential rental income. Located just minutes from downtown Lakehills, this property offers easy access to grocery stores, gas stations, and Medina Lake, making it a great option for those who enjoy boating, fishing, and outdoor recreation. Commuters will appreciate the proximity-approximately 20 minutes to Helotes, 25 minutes to San Antonio, and 40 minutes to Lackland Air Force Base. This is rural Hill Country living at its finest, offering acreage, versatility, and location-without sacrificing access to city amenities.

For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
